But Slightly mad Studios have released a new video for Project CARS, and this one takes you inside the Pit Box.

As always, the detail, authenticity, and of course, the visual splendor of the game continue to astonish, and seeing a video for the game almost makes me hyped up for it again. it almost makes me believe ibn it again. Almost.

That said, I’m not going to fall for this again.

Project CARS is due out on Xbox One, PlayStation 4, and PC in mid-May (no concrete release date has been announced yet). It was originally due out in November, before it was delayed to March of this year; in February, it was delayed to April, and earlier this week, it was delayed again to May.

If and when it does release, a Wii U version is slated to follow the other three versions some time after their launch.
